To Nicolas' reply, the next worked for me as that response did not have form="button" as a consequence of which it commenced behaving as submit type...considering the fact that I already have a single submit kind. It didn't perform for me ... and now you may possibly incorporate a class to your button or to to have the demanded layout:
If you want to stay clear of needing to make use of a kind or an input and you're looking for a button-looking link, you can develop good-searching button links using a div wrapper, an anchor and an h1 tag.
– user4880619 Commented Sep 29, 2022 at 15:44 SvenskiNavi - I realize what does one signify - thank for that info. Nevertheless I comprehend OP issue that he basically would like to get Connection which only looks like button (he write: "button that acts like a url" - so in my view he would like to bring about it by enter important - not Room bar - to maintain url conduct)
If for some explanation, accessibility is vital (JavaScript is just not an alternative) however , you are in a very problem where your style and design and/or your server configuration is stopping you from applying solution #one, then Answer #three (Anchor styled similar to a button) is an efficient alternative fix this issue with nominal usability affect.
You would potentially want this to help you freely put the link-button about your page. This is especially handy for horizontally centering buttons and getting vertically-centered text inside of them. Here's how:
six @UriahsVictor It may work today, but at some point browser vendors might choose to alter the actions as it's not legitimate.
one "Adhere to the hyperlink" is seems like an incredibly official or tutorial method of referring to it. Usual persons Do not declare that, they'd normally say "Click/press to the hyperlink" or "Open the connection" (preferred as it's inclusive to all gadgets) in its place.
Identical configurations could vary according to the webserver and stack applied. So a summary of this strategy:
around the URL. That is because of the shape getting sort="GET", improve this to form="Put up" plus the ? at the conclusion of the URL disappears. This is because GET sends all variables within the URL, therefore the ?.
Watch out to make certain the button isn't going to trigger any action, as which will bring about a conflict. Also as Arius pointed out, you ought to be knowledgeable that, for the above mentioned motive, this is not strictly speaking considered valid HTML, in accordance with the regular.
2 When People are legitimate details, I don't seriously Assume that basically tackle accessibility. Did you signify usability, not accessibility? In Internet advancement accessibility is frequently reserved to get particularly about regardless of whether buyers that have visual impairments can function your software properly.
You don't need to contend with sorts in case you are just looking to move to another web page. Sorts are designed for inputting details, and they ought to be reserved for that.
The # on the url Click here is website link to the best of the current web site. But these sort of # hyperlinks are sometimes also useful for backlinks which have been generated by JavaScript.
The button is now regarded like/to be a submit button (HTML5). I've tried Operating Visit Website a method close to and have found this technique.
You could possibly just make the Show:block, shift it about, and style it for a button, but then vertically aligning textual content within it gets hard.